Segment Mode Typical time Typical cost Notes
Springfield β London Flight 11β15h with connection $700β$1,200 Usually routes via a major US hub before London.
London β Prague Train 14β17h $165β$255+ Typically Eurostar to Brussels, then onward rail or sleeper to Prague.
London β Prague Flight 2β3h airborne, longer door-to-door $80β$220+ Faster, but less aligned with a train-first itinerary.
Prague β Essen Train 8β9h $40β$140+ Commonly DB / ICE / EC with one or more changes.
Prague β Essen Flight 4β6h total with airport overhead $120β$280+ May involve DΓΌsseldorf or another nearby airport for the Ruhr area.
Essen β Springfield Flight 12β17h with train or airport transfer $750β$1,300 Essen usually departs via DΓΌsseldorf or Frankfurt rather than a local long-haul airport.
Passport validity Carry a valid US passport. For Schengen travel, it should be valid for at least 3 months beyond your planned departure from the Schengen Area.
UK ETA For 2026 travel, US citizens need a UK Electronic Travel Authorisation before travel to or transit through the UK when border control applies.
Schengen 90/180 rule Czech Republic and Germany count toward the shared Schengen allowance of up to 90 days in any rolling 180-day period for short visits.
Separate UK and Schengen entry checks The UK is outside Schengen, so London entry is separate from your Schengen entry when you continue to Prague.
Rail booking details Book Eurostar, any sleeper reservation, and DB long-distance tickets early, and keep station transfer details handy for Brussels or Germany connections.
Transit and hotel buffer Set aside extra budget for airport rail transfers, baggage fees, seat reservations, city transit, and travel insurance.
